Jenka's hat trick boosts EHV Schönheide over Tornado Niesky, 8-4Eisstadion Schönheide Sun, Mar 18, 2012 Tornado Niesky could not stop EHV Schönheide's Miroslav Jenka, who tallied a hat trick in an 8-4 win. Jenka got on the scoresheet 22 seconds into the first period. He then added goals at 6:15 into the second and at 6:54 into the third.EHV Schönheide stifled Tornado Niesky's power play, and did not give up a single goal while down a man. EHV Schönheide additionally got points from Mike Losch, who also registered two goals and four assists and Petr Kukla, who also had two goals and two assists. EHV Schönheide also got a goal from Patrick Preiß as well. In addition, EHV Schönheide received assists from David Seidl, who had two and Bjorn Schenkel, Christian Heumann, Marcus Löffler, Dustin Hered, and Roy Hähnlein, who contributed one a piece. Tornado Niesky was held below its usual level of production. Tornado Niesky averages 6.2 goals per game. Tornado Niesky could not stay out of the penalty box, as the team accrued 48 minutes in penalties during the game. Tornado Niesky was helped by Daniel Bartell, who tallied two goals and one assist. Bartell scored the first of his two goals at 9:48 into the second period to make the score 3-3. Mojmir Musil assisted on the tally. Bartell's next tally made the score 5-4 EHV Schönheide with 16:48 left in the third period. Musil picked up the assist. Marcel Linke also scored for Tornado Niesky. More assists for Tornado Niesky came via Vitezslav Jankovych, who had three and Daniel Wahne and Stephan Kuhlee, who each chipped in one. EHV Schönheide incurred 38 minutes in penalty time with four minors. EHV Schönheide ran into serious disciplinary problems during the contest, and Christian Müller was ejected from the game. Tornado Niesky registered zero goals on four power play opportunities.
